IN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S This unit is designed for installation in cars, trucks, and vans with an existing radio opening. In many cases, a special installation kit will be required to mount the radio to the dashboard. These kits are available at electronics supply stores and car stereo specialist shops. Always check the kit application before purchasing to make sure the kit works with your vehicle. If you need a kit but cannot find it available, call our toll-free “HELP” line.

bl AM ANTENNA TRIMMER It is very important to adjust the Antenna Trimmer for optimum AM reception. The antenna trimmer is located on left rear corner of the chassis. Adjust this control after wiring connections are complete and before the radio is inserted into the dashboard opening. Proceed as follows: 1.Tune in a weak station around 1400 kHz on the AM band. 2.Using a small screwdriver, slowly adjust the trimmer for maximum output from the radio.
bp FRONT PANEL RELEASE (REL) BUTTON DETACHING THE FRONT PANEL This button is used to release the mechanism that holds the front panel to the chassis. To detach the front panel, press the button so that the right side of the panel is released. Grasp the released side and pull it off of the chassis.
